Inmate Information

Information regarding inmates held at the Napa County Department of Corrections, CA, is available 24 hours a day, seven days a week. You can access Napa County Department of Corrections’s information using the following two options:

  • Visit the Napa County Department of Corrections’s website website
  • Call the Napa County Department of Corrections at 707-253-4509

It is important to note that Napa County Department of Corrections inmate information is usually available only two hours after the inmate’s booking time.

Usually, offenders held in Napa County Department of Corrections must be arraigned within 2 days after the arrest. Visiting Hours

Generally, Napa County Department of Corrections allows inmates to receive visitors on specified days and hours. Family and friends can visit an inmate from Tuesdays through Sundays between 9 am to 5 pm. Usually, the Napa County Department of Corrections does not require any visitation reservations. However, it is advisable to always call ahead before planning a visit to the Napa County Department of Corrections because these hours are typically subject to change without prior notice. Additionally, some inmates at the Napa County Department of Corrections may not have visiting privileges.

Napa County Department of Corrections permits only one visit per scheduled visiting day with a maximum of 5 people at a time.

It is important to note that the members of the clergy or attorneys have access to the Napa County Department of Corrections inmates at any time and any day of the week.
